Step-by-step inst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. Brown the ground beef in a skillet over medium heat until fully cooked. Remember to drain the excess fat for a less greasy pocket.
  3. Mix the cooked beef with the ketchup and shredded cheese until well combined.
  4. Flatten each biscuit into a round disc about 1/4 inch thick.
  5. Place a measured amount of the beef mixture in the center of each biscuit.
  6. Fold the dough over the filling and seal the edges tightly. You can crimp the edges with your fingertips or use a fork for a more decorative touch.
  7. Arrange the prepared hot pockets on the baking sheet.
  8. Bake in the preheated oven until golden brown, approximately 15-20 minutes.
  9. Let cool briefly before serving, as the filling will be hot!

Best ways to enjoy it

Serving these Cheeseburger Hot Pockets can be just as fun as making them! They can be enjoyed plain or with a selection of tasty dips. Here are some pairing ideas:

  • Serve with crispy french fries or sweet potato fries for a hearty meal.
  • A side salad can add freshness and balance to this dish.
  • Consider offering ranch dressing, BBQ sauce, or additional ketchup for dipping.

For a fun twist, put together a mini dipping station with a selection of sauces to keep things interesting!

Storage and reheating tips

To keep your Cheeseburger Hot Pockets fresh:

  • Refrigerate leftovers in an airtight container for up to three days.
  • Freeze them (unbaked) for up to two months. Just wrap them well for protection against freezer burn.
  • To reheat, bake in the oven at 350°F (175°C) for 10-15 minutes or until warmed through. If you prefer the microwave, heat them in short intervals, checking so they don’t get rubbery.

Helpful cooking tips

  1. Short on time? Use pre-cooked ground beef or rotisserie chicken to expedite the process.
  2. Customize your flavors by adding spices or herbs to the ground beef concoction for a flavor boost.

Creative twists

Don’t be afraid to get creative! Here are some variations to consider:

  • BBQ Cheeseburger: Swap ketchup for your favorite BBQ sauce for a smoky flavor.
  • Veggie-Packed: Add finely chopped bell peppers or mushrooms to the beef mixture for more nutrition.
  • Cheesy Spin: Try using a mix of cheeses like mozzarella and pepper jack for an extra cheesy pocket with a kick.

Your questions answered

How long does it take to make Cheeseburger Hot Pockets?

The entire process takes about 30-45 minutes, including preparation and cooking time.

Can I use a different type of meat?

Absolutely! Ground turkey, chicken, or even vegetarian options like crumbled tofu work beautifully in this recipe.

What’s the best way to reheat leftovers?

Reheat in the oven at 350°F for 10-15 minutes for the best texture. The microwave can work too, but it may make the dough a bit chewy.

How do I store these hot pockets?

Keep them in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days, or freeze unbaked for up to two months. Reheat at 350°F until warmed through.
